Market Sizing, Growth Estimates, and CAGR Projections

Based on a rigorous analysis of macroeconomic indicators, industrial output, and technological adoption rates, the South Korea nitrogen tester market was valued at approximately USD 150 million

in 2023. The market is projected to grow at a comp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of 8.5%

over the next five years, reaching an estimated USD 245 million

by 2028.

Key assumptions underpinning these estimates include continued industrial expansion, increased adoption of precision agriculture, and stricter environmental regulations that necessitate accurate nitrogen measurement in various sectors. The growth is further supported by rising investments in R&D, digitalization initiatives, and cross-industry collaborations.

Market Ecosystem & Demand-Supply Framework

Key Product Categories

  • Portable Nitrogen Testers:

    Handheld devices suitable for field testing in agriculture, environmental surveys, and small-scale industrial applications.

  • Laboratory-Grade Nitrogen Analyzers:

    High-precision instruments used in R&D, quality control, and regulatory compliance.

  • Inline/Process Nitrogen Sensors:

    Integrated systems deployed in manufacturing lines for continuous monitoring and automation.

Value Chain & Revenue Models

The nitrogen tester value chain encompasses raw material sourcing (sensor components, electronics, casing materials), manufacturing (assembly, calibration, quality assurance), distribution (direct sales, third-party distributors), and end-user delivery (installation, training, maintenance).

Revenue streams

include:

  • Product sales (hardware & software licenses)
  • Subscription & SaaS-based data analytics services
  • Calibration, maintenance, and lifecycle management services
  • Training & consulting services for optimal deployment

The lifecycle of nitrogen testers involves ongoing calibration, software updates, and hardware upgrades, creating recurring revenue opportunities and fostering long-term customer relationships.

Adoption Trends & Use Cases

Major end-user segments exhibit distinct adoption patterns:

  • Agriculture:

    Growing adoption of portable nitrogen testers for precision fertilization, exemplified by pilot programs in rice and vegetable farming, leading to fertilizer savings of up to 20% and yield improvements.

  • Environmental Monitoring:

    Deployment of inline sensors in water treatment plants to ensure compliance with environmental standards, reducing violations and penalties.

  • Manufacturing:

    Integration of inline nitrogen sensors in chemical production lines to optimize process parameters, reduce waste, and enhance product quality.

Shifting consumption patterns favor digital, portable, and integrated solutions, driven by Industry 4.0 initiatives and sustainability mandates.
